Transaction f4b71da3968d24fc71f281c998d8ade676d69050cf524df29392b437bbf7253e
1 Input
2 Outputs
- f4b71da3968d24fc71f281c998d8ade676d69050cf524df29392b437bbf7253e:0
- f4b71da3968d24fc71f281c998d8ade676d69050cf524df29392b437bbf7253e:1
value 1461176
address 33BqvgkESsyBT1uBsh35Lr7niyGaZUq7rQ
value 70759980
address 17AdygaUsgpQNhkdMjdRpozqez3sk9MdWh